Output 66efeb3b604e364ed5419ebb728561ff7e0c415f027a177f574b07d084f817b0:0

value
24246315
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8f37ba3fd9ba142df2ee09899c6112c56854afc9 OP_EQUALVERIFY OP_CHECKSIG
address
LYHDefLtEwy5VJxwejwg7gkxA4tSp2au71
transaction
66efeb3b604e364ed5419ebb728561ff7e0c415f027a177f574b07d084f817b0
spent
true